One Bad Burger Saved RDJ's Life

The meme features a movie screenshot of Robert Downey Jr. (RDJ) in a dark suit, surrounded by formally dressed people and a crowd. The top text explains RDJ's real-life anecdote: a bad Burger King meal prompted his decision to quit drugs, with the key line 'One bad burger saved RDJ's life.' The bottom text from @moviemirrorbyavi adds humor: 'Iron Man was born... because of a bad burger? McRockbottom meets McRedemption. I'm lovin' it.' (a play on McDonald's slogans, combining 'rock bottom' and 'redemption').
